BeckerP.O. Ronald G. Becker, Jr. Way (Bronx) Present name:Washington Avenue Location:At 830 Washington Avenue Honoree: Ronald Becker (1958-2012) served in the United States Navy and with the New York City Police Department for 20 years. He was assigned to the 42nd Precinct in the Bronx and made more than 50 arrests and was recognized once for Excellent Police Duty and once for Meritorious Police Duty. He died from illnesses he contracted after inhaling toxic materials as he participated in the rescue and recovery efforts at the World Trade Center site following the terrorist attacks on September 11, 2001. (Gibson) LL:2015/76 Walter Becker Way (Queens) Present name:None Location:Intersection of 112th Street and 72nd Drive Honoree: Walter Carl Becker (1950-2017) was an American musician, songwriter, bassist and record producer. He was a native of Forest Hills, Queens, growing up at 112-20 72nd Drive in Forest Hills. In 1971, Walter Becker and his partner, Donald Fagen, formed the jazz-rock band Steely Dan. They produced music that was highly regarded by critics and fellow musicians alike, and sustained a devoted audience for over 40 years. In 2000, Steely Dan won four Grammys, including Record of the Year. Steely Dan was inducted into the Rock N Roll Hall of Fame in 2001. (Koslowitz) LL:2018/139 |
